    Restoring Grandad's ol 56

    I'm sure It's going to be a long process full of blood, sweat, tears, beers and swearing but in the end it'll all be worth it.
    It's a 1956 GMC 100 series pick up. It's all original with a sb 316. This truck was bought by my great-grandfather and has been in our family for four generations now. When I was a kid I used to spend the summer with my grandparents working at our family farm. We would use this truck to haul cattle from Floresville to union stockyards in San Antonio.
    My grandpa passed away in July and since then we have been cleaning out his house and the barns. Here's a a pic of it buried in the barn
    I finally got it dug out and over to my house.
    After cleaning the carb, replacing a few fuel lines and setting the points it was up and running. It has a few cancer spots in the normal areas like lower doors and front fenders but all in all its in pretty good shape.
